Elizabeth (Mahoney) Bohenko, 78, of Lowell passed away peacefully, July 25, 2018 surrounded by her loving family.
Born in Lowell on November 22, 1939, Elizabeth was the daughter of the late Eileen and John Mahoney. She attended school at St Patrick’s and Keith Academy in Lowell. She was a lifelong resident of the Highlands section of Lowell. She was a communicant of Saint Margaret Parish.
Elizabeth devoted herself to her family and will forever be remembered as an outstanding caregiver. Through the years, she loved watching her five sons play baseball at Callery Park in Lowell. She cherished her five sons and loved spending time with her grandchildren, nieces and nephews.
